Car Key Cutting Near Me

Getting a new key made isn't always a quick or cheap process. It doesn't matter if you go to the hardware store or a locksmith, costs vary depending on the type and the complexity of your key.

Basic home, luggage keys for safes and house are usually inexpensive to duplicate. Modern car keys have chips or transponders that require a professional program.

Laser-Cut Keys

Laser-cut keys are an excellent option for those who want to add a layer of security to their car. They can be purchased from a locksmith who is a professional and are much more difficult to duplicate than conventional keys. They are also less likely to be stuck in the ignition.

A laser-cut is the next level of an ordinary transponder or key. It requires more advanced equipment to make. Laser-cut keys are made by cutting the key's metal to a pre-set, precise depth. The upper and lower sides of the key are cut with this method, and a "smart" part inside the key can be programmed. This lets the key operate locks and ignitions, but the engine still needs to be started using a conventional key.

Keys like these are typically used in luxury cars and offer a high level of security for your car. Unlike regular key blanks, which can be cut with any key cutting car machine, a laser cut key must be made by a skilled professional at a locksmith's shop or at the dealership. This is due to the fact that the laser-cut key is unique in its design and can't be duplicated.

Laser-cut keys offer a higher level of durability than regular keys. They are stronger and thicker with a groove in the middle, rather than notches on the edges. They can be placed from either side and even work with the keys upside down. Laser-cut keys can be used with any type of door or ignition cylinder lock and will function regardless of the direction they are placed in.

These keys are also harder to pick. They are made using the use of a laser, which is more precise and has a higher tolerance than a standard one. This makes it impossible to duplicate them using the standard key cutting machine. A skilled locksmith can make a key that is laser-cut however the equipment required is more expensive than the tools needed for standard keys.
